Definitions of antitrust word

  • adjective antitrust In the United States, antitrust laws are intended to stop large firms taking over their competitors, fixing prices with their competitors, or interfering with free competition in any way. 3
  • noun antitrust regulating or opposing trusts, monopolies, cartels, or similar organizations, esp in order to prevent unfair competition 3
  • adjective antitrust opposed to or regulating trusts; specif., designating or of federal laws, suits, etc. designed to prevent restraints on trade, as by business monopolies, cartels, etc. 3
  • adjective antitrust Antitrust activities are illegal activities that unfairly reduce competition, such as price-fixing, monopolies, and restraint of trade. 3
  • adjective antitrust opposing or intended to restrain trusts, monopolies, or other large combinations of business and capital, especially with a view to maintaining and promoting competition: antitrust legislation. 1
  • noun antitrust Of or relating to legislation preventing or controlling trusts or other monopolies, with the intention of promoting competition in business. 1

Origin of antitrust

First appearance:

before 1885
One of the 21% newest English words
An Americanism dating back to 1885-90; anti- + trust
